Reverter of Sites Act 1987 (1987 c 15)

This Act addressed the automatic reversion of certain properties previously given for educational or religious purposes if they ceased being used for those purposes. It provided statutory clarity for reversion rights, facilitating easier identification and exercise of those rights by rightful owners. The legislation sought to mitigate legal confusion and disputes, ensuring fair re-allocation of land and property to original owners or their heirs when the initial dedicated use was abandoned. This supported better management of historically gifted sites by updating and streamlining property reverter processes.
